Job Summary

Lead Skydio's employment-law function as a director-level partner to People Operations, advising on recruitment, leaves, wage and hour, investigations, and international expansion while coordinating with outside counsel on high-risk matters. Own day-to-day employment counseling, shape HR policy, training, and employee handbook, and help scale compliance across manufacturing, field operations, and corporate teams.
Location: San Mateo
Workplace: Hybrid
Employment Type: Full time
Job Function: Legal, Risk & Compliance
Seniority: Sr. Manager level

Key Responsibilities

  • •Be the primary legal partner for People Operations, handling day-to-day employment counseling and coordinating with outside counsel on high-risk or international matters
  • •Anticipate employment-law risks early and address them pragmatically
  • •Provide scalable guidance on recruitment/pre-hire issues, leaves, accommodations, investigations, wage/hour, performance management, HR policy, and separations
  • •Ensure manufacturing, field operations, and corporate employment practices are compliant, safe, and operationally realistic
  • •Draft and review training materials and provide targeted training to people leaders

Key Requirements

  • •You hold a JD and are admitted to practice in California
  • •10+ years of in-house experience (or similar law firm experience advising startups)
  • •Experience advising companies with hourly employees, especially in California manufacturing
  • •Must be able to work onsite at least 3 days per week: at our Hayward manufacturing site and at our HQ in San Mateo
  • •Strong ability to triage, prioritize, and manage multiple projects with competing deadlines

Company Brief

Skydio
Designs and manufactures autonomous consumer and enterprise drones using AI-powered vision and navigation systems for inspection, mapping, public safety, and industrial applications. Focuses on rugged, fully autonomous flight and end-to-end drone solutions.
